General Information
Title: Beata viscera
Composer: Nobuaki Izawa
Source of text: Luke 11:27
Number of voices: 4vv Voicing: SATB
Genre: Sacred, Motet, Communion for Visitation, Assumption (Vigil), Nativity of the BVM
Language: Latin
Instruments: A cappella
First published: 2020
